siege after the two armies at vicksburg go into siege operations. and really nothing has happened. there's not movement of money armies. it's a slow slog, sort of world war one ish kind of battle. and on a riverboat apparently yes grant got pretty well drunk. other than that we don't have a lot of real strong evidence that this was the case grant his credit recognized he had a problem with drink and he took steps to try to mitigate it. one his chief of staff, who will eventually be a general in the war john rawlins, was his name. a friend of grant's back to to illinois and to all the demands of chief of staff. the commander in army, one of rawlins job was to monitor in the camps and around the vicksburg time. rawlins sent a letter saying that if there is another incident like this, he, rawlins will resign. and so grant understood, there was a seriousness to his drink. there's there's one intriguing letter he writes to his wife, which he says, thank mrs. so-and-so for sending the bottle of bourbon. he was specific. he bourbon. you'll be happy to know

vicksburg. gettysburg. chicoms. all got the scale of. the calamity revealed itself. writing the first on that grizzly list, general grant recalled that the earth at shiloh was so covered with dead that it would have been possible walk in any direction stepping on dead bodies without foot, touching the ground ground. before the war was over. at least three quarters of a million bodies equivalent to some 8 million today had been put under the ground, including roughly 17,000 black soldiers who gave their lives for the union. not to mention countless formerly enslaved persons who abandoned by their former masters died of disease or starvation. president lincoln was not much of a churchgoer, but like of his time, most americans of his time, he was a believer in his second inaugural address delivered on march four, 1865, on the steps of recently desecrated capitol, he quoted matthew. 218 woe to the man by whom the offense cometh to say that suffering on such a scale could only be to the righteous wrath of god and. he was careful to identify provoking sin not as southerner

with aaron riggs, b who's a professional storm chase that he's joining us from this vicksburg in mississippi . thank you so much. and for being with us, as you heard a correspondent, their unclear whether it was one tornado or several of them that cause the destruction, the widespread destruction that we've seen in mississippi. the national weather service has been talking about the possibility that the devastation was caused by what it says was a skipping tornado. what is that, and how different is it from a normal tornado and how dangerous is it? yeah, it's actually what that is is that the storm is what we call it cyclic super cells . so as one tornado was broken out. another one immediately touches down right after it. so the cyclic super cells can oftentimes we can think that it's only one single tornado tracking over a very long distance. but as the damage surveys are conducted, they can see those missing points between tornadoes and determine if it was one long tornado or multiple large tornadoes. produced by the same storm, which is equally as impressive with the parameter space that
